 UTC MJE13001
FEATURES
* Collector-Base Voltage: V(BR)CBO=600V * Collector Current: IC=0.2A
NPN EPITAXIAL SILICON TRANSISTOR
1
TO-92
1: BASE 2: COLLECTOR 3: EMITTER
ABSOLUTE MAXIMUM RATINGS
PARAMETER
Collector-base voltage Collector-emitter voltage Emitter-base voltage Collector current Collector power dissipation Junction Temperature Storage Temperature
SYMBOL
VCBO VCEO VEBO Ic Pc Tj TSTG
RATING
600 400 7 200 750 150 -55 ~ +150
UNIT
V V V mA mW C C
